I was very interested by the study found here:
http://papers.ssrn.com/sol3/papers.cfm?abstract_id=1901654
according to this paper, in their sampling of about a million male voters and using the 2008 election, Total registered versus total citizens voting: 86.2% of White men were registered to vote; of that only some 60% actually voted. 75% of Black men were registered to vote, but only about 45% voted. And 67% of Hispanic men were registered but only about 40% voted.
Now even deducting a few percentage points for the elderly or infirm voter, or those ‘on the fringe’, we’re still left with a significant percentage of registered, non-felon, male citizen voters that simply don’t vote.
